Fund an awareness raising campaign that explains how to claim pension credit.

Since recent news about the elderly being charged the TV license fee, many of these 75+, don’t claim the pension credit which if they were on the scheme would mean they wouldn’t have to pay. I believe that many who don’t, need help on understanding how the pension credit works and how to claim it.
